Rules to Create the Process for Becoming a Secure Voter

Authority and Purpose These rules are promulgated pursuant to Act 980 of 2021. The purpose of these rules is to create the process by which registered voters who are victims of domestic violence may shield their address or addresses from public view by becoming a secure voter.
